#23ACB3 Color
#23ACB3 is rgb(35, 172, 179) in RGB, hsl(183, 67%, 42%) in HSL, and about cmyk(80%, 4%, 0%, 30%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Verdigris (#43B3AE),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.4.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#23ACB3 Channel Values
How #23ACB3 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 35 · G 172 · B 179 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 183° · S 67% · L 42%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 183° · S 80% · V 70%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 80% · M 4% · Y 0% · K 30%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.75:1 vs white · 7.62: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#23ACB3 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#23ACB3 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#23ACB3?
#23ACB3 is a mid-tone teal — rgb(35, 172, 179) in RGB and hsl(183, 67%, 42%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Verdigris (#43B3AE),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.4.
What is the RGB value of #23ACB3?
#23ACB3 is rgb(35, 172, 179) — red 35, green 172, and blue 179 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#23ACB3?
#23ACB3 converts to approximately cmyk(80%, 4%, 0%, 30%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#23ACB3 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#23ACB3 scores 2.75:1 against white and 7.62: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#23ACB3 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#23ACB3 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is lightseagreen (#20B2AA) at a CIE76 distance of 8.91,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
